Well, I prefer waiting at the front of the pack than the back of it. The good news our trip is that the "run" was not bad at all for any of our days.

AK: They walk you behind a rope for EE and KS.
DHS: No pre-show and no one really running. We rode TSMM twice in Standby and once with FPs, ToT, and RnRC in 45-60 minutes of entry. That left us to the everything else with plenty of time.
MK: We were at rope drop for Belle's story time, meeting Merida, and for Space Mountain. No real big rushes or running necessary.
Epcot: We did not go on this trip. There is no real rush there. We would go to Soarin and hope my daughter will go on it.

Usually 30-45 mins before, depending on the predictions for crowd levels that day. I think 1 hour before is the earliest we have been. I prefer to at least be able to get through the turnstiles prior to the show starting.
